Leaving outdoor Christmas lights on overnight is generally safe if you use lights that are labeled for outdoor use and have been properly tested. Ensure they are plugged into GFCI outlets to prevent electrical hazards, and regularly check for any exposed wires or damage to avoid potential risks.

FAQs & Answers

  1. What type of Christmas lights are safe for outdoor use? Always choose lights labeled for outdoor use, which are specifically designed to withstand weather elements.
  2. How can I prevent electrical hazards with Christmas lights? Use GFCI outlets and regularly inspect your lights for damage and exposed wires.
  3. Can leaving outdoor lights on all night increase my electricity bill? Yes, running the lights overnight may increase energy use, but LED lights are energy-efficient alternatives.
  4. Is it safer to use timers for outdoor Christmas lights? Using timers can enhance safety by preventing overuse and reducing fire risks from prolonged exposure.
